I own two of them and would not consider the color print quality anything above basic. For photo prints, there is no better way than a dedicated photo printer. I've never seen, or heard, of any printer that could do both well. The Eco Tank printer is directed at 'business' printing where something color could be used for illustrative purposes or a color sign is being printed. They are definitely NOT high end. For the price, and for the low cost of replacement ink, they are priceless. I use one of these, a small HP Laser printer and an Epson P800 for photo prints. This fits in the price range you stated, but you do get what you pay for. Best of luck.
